Tools You Need
Before you start removing the door panel, you need to prepare the tools you need. Here are some of the essential tools:
1. Screwdriver
You'll need a screwdriver to remove the screws that hold the door panel in place. A Phillips head screwdriver is the most common type of screwdriver used for this task.
2. Pliers
Pliers are handy for removing the clips that hold the door panel on. They can also be useful for bending and shaping metal parts.
3. Trim Removal Tool
A trim removal tool is designed to help you remove the clips and fasteners that hold the door panel on. It's a plastic tool that won't scratch or damage the interior of your car.
Precautions to Take
Before you start removing the door panel, you need to take some precautions to avoid damaging your car or getting injured. Here are some precautions to take:
1. Disconnect the Battery
Before you start working on any electrical components in your car, you need to disconnect the battery. This will prevent any electrical shocks or damage to your car's electrical system.
2. Wear Safety Gear
Wear safety gear such as gloves and safety glasses to protect your hands and eyes from any sharp or hazardous materials.
3. Be Gentle
When removing the door panel, be gentle and take your time. Don't rush or use excessive force, as this can damage the door panel or other components in your car.
Step-by-Step Guide to F150 Door Panel Removal
Step 1: Remove the Screws
The first step in removing the door panel is to remove the screws that hold it in place. These screws are usually located around the edges of the door panel and in the armrest. Use your screwdriver to remove the screws.
Step 2: Remove the Clips
After removing the screws, use your trim removal tool or pliers to remove the clips that hold the door panel on. These clips are located around the edges of the door panel and in the middle. Gently pry them off, being careful not to damage the panel or the clips.
Step 3: Disconnect the Electrical Connections
If your car has electric windows, door locks, or mirrors, you'll need to disconnect the electrical connections before removing the door panel. Use your trim removal tool to gently pry off the electrical connectors. Be careful not to damage the wires or connectors.
Step 4: Lift the Door Panel Off
After removing the screws, clips, and electrical connections, lift the door panel off the door frame. Be careful not to damage the panel or the door frame.
Tips and Tricks for Easy Door Panel Removal
Here are some tips and tricks to make the door panel removal process easier:
1. Use a Plastic Bag
When you remove the screws, put them in a plastic bag so you don't lose them. This will also make it easier to find them when you need to put the door panel back on.
2. Label the Electrical Connections
Label the electrical connections so you know which one goes where when you need to reconnect them. Use a piece of tape or a marker to label each connector.
3. Take Pictures
Take pictures of the door panel before you remove it. This will help you remember how it was assembled and make it easier to put it back together.
